如何在在线活动直播系统中实现智能推荐系统?

随着互联网技术的不断发展,在线活动直播系统已经成为人们生活中不可或缺的一部分。为了提升用户体验,实现精准推荐,如何在在线活动直播系统中实现智能推荐系统成为了一个热门话题。本文将围绕这一主题,探讨如何构建一个高效、精准的智能推荐系统。

一、智能推荐系统的重要性

在在线活动直播系统中,智能推荐系统具有以下重要意义:

  1. 提升用户体验:通过智能推荐,用户可以快速找到感兴趣的活动,提高观看满意度。
  2. 增加用户粘性:精准的推荐能够满足用户个性化需求,提升用户对平台的忠诚度。
  3. 提高平台活跃度:智能推荐系统有助于发现潜在用户,扩大用户群体,提高平台活跃度。

二、构建智能推荐系统的关键步骤

  1. 数据收集与分析:收集用户行为数据、活动数据、用户画像等,通过数据挖掘技术,分析用户兴趣和行为模式。

  2. 推荐算法设计:根据数据分析和业务需求,选择合适的推荐算法,如协同过滤、基于内容的推荐、混合推荐等。

  3. 模型训练与优化:利用历史数据对推荐模型进行训练,不断优化模型性能,提高推荐准确性。

  4. 系统部署与监控:将推荐系统部署到线上环境,并对系统进行实时监控,确保系统稳定运行。

三、案例分析

以某知名在线直播平台为例,该平台通过以下方式实现智能推荐:

  1. 用户画像:根据用户历史观看记录、评论、点赞等行为,构建用户画像,了解用户兴趣和偏好。
  2. 协同过滤:利用用户之间的相似度,推荐相似用户喜欢的内容。
  3. 基于内容的推荐:根据用户观看过的活动类型、标签等信息,推荐相似类型的活动。
  4. 混合推荐:结合多种推荐算法,提高推荐效果。

通过以上措施,该平台实现了精准推荐,用户满意度大幅提升,平台活跃度也随之增加。

四、总结

在在线活动直播系统中实现智能推荐系统,对于提升用户体验、增加用户粘性、提高平台活跃度具有重要意义。通过数据收集与分析、推荐算法设计、模型训练与优化、系统部署与监控等关键步骤,构建一个高效、精准的智能推荐系统,将为在线直播行业带来新的发展机遇。

猜你喜欢:声网 rtc